vue人力管理_springboot+vue微人事人力资源管理系统,前后台分离源码
购买须知:
(1)因送吗安装费用的调整,故需要安装的用户请先联络我们!无联络硬拍的慎重!
(2)联络好了安装的用户请自行备好服务器域名等...
(3)素质低下,贪小便宜,追求完美者请绕道!
(4)手动发货一般发送吗注册的qq邮箱!一般发货时间为8:30-21:30.超时隔日补发邮箱!
微人事是一个前后台分离的人力资源管理系统,项目采用SpringBoot+Vue开发
前后台分离项目。
发前台和后台源码,以及sql文件。其余文档没有,功能详情,只发源码,不包部署,
,下面有部署方案。
后台技术栈
1.SpringBoot2.SpringSecurity3.MyBatis4.MySQL
前台技术栈
1.Vue2.ElementUI3.axios4.vue-router
还有其余少量琐碎的技术就不逐个列举了。
开发中具备的功能:
权限管理模块已经开发完成
2018.1.10 升级
本次升级版本:v20180110
本次升级完成了部门管理功能,页面在 [系统管理->基础信息设置->部门管理]
2018.1.12 升级
本次升级版本:v20180112
本次升级完成了职称管理和职位管理,页面在 [系统管理->基础信息设置->职位管理] 和 [系统管理->基础信息设置->职称管理]
2018.1.15 升级
本次升级版本:v20180115
本次升级完成了员工基本信息管理,页面在 [员工资料->基本资料]
2018.1.16 升级
本次升级版本:v20180116
本次升级完成了员工的高级搜索功能,页面在 [员工资料->基本资料]
018.1.17 升级
本次升级版本:v20180117
本次升级完成了员工数据的导入导出功能,就可将员工数据导出为Excel,也可以将外部Excel导入到员工数据表中,页面在 [员工资料->基本资料]
2018.1.19 升级
本次升级版本:v20180119
本次升级主要实现了当管理员增加一个客户时,增加成功后,会根据该客户的邮箱自动向客户发送一封欢迎入职邮件,页面在 [员工资料->基本资料->增加员工] 介绍可以参考下面的文档。 注意:邮件发送需要小伙伴小伙伴自己配置受权码,配置方式参考下面的文档,配置文件在src/main/java/org/sang/common/EmailRunnable.java
SpringBoot中使用Freemarker邮件模板生成邮件Java中邮件的发送SpringBoot中使用新线程发送邮件
2018.1.25 升级
本次升级版本:v20180125
本次升级主要完成了工资账套管理功能,页面在 [薪资管理->工资账套管理]
2018.1.26 升级
本次升级版本:v20180126
本次升级主要完成了员工账套设置功能,页面在 [薪资管理->员工账套设置]
2018.2.2 升级
本次升级版本:v20180202
本次升级完成了HR在线聊天功能,页面在 [Home页->右上角铃铛->好友聊天]
2018.2.5 升级
本次升级版本:v20180205
本次升级完成了管理员发送系统通知功能,页面在 [Home页->右上角铃铛->系统通知]
首先,不同的客户在登录成功之后,根据不同的角色,会看到不同的系统菜单,完整菜单如下:
快速部署
1.clone项目到本地git@github.com:lenve/vhr.git
2.数据库脚本放在hrserver项目的resources目录下,在MySQL中执行数据库脚本
3.数据库配置在hrserver项目的resources目录下的application.properties文件中
4.在IntelliJ IDEA中运行hrserver项目
OK,至此,服务端就启动成功了,此时我们直接在地址栏输入http://localhost:8082/index.html就可访问我们的项目,假如要做二次开发,请继续看第五、六步。
5.进入到vuehr目录中,在命令行依次输入如下命令:
# 安装依赖 npm install # 在 localhost:8080 启动项目 npm run dev
因为我在vuehr项目中已经配置了端口转发,将数据转发到SpringBoot上,因而项目启动之后,在浏览器中输入http://localhost:8080即可以访问我们的前台项目了,所有的请求通过端口转发将数据传到SpringBoot中(注意此时不要关闭SpringBoot项目)。
6.可以用WebStorm等工具打开vuehr项目,继续开发,开发完成后,当项目要上线时,仍然进入到vuehr目录,而后执行如下命令:
npm run build
该命令执行成功之后,vuehr目录下生成一个dist文件夹,将该文件夹中的两个文件static和index.html拷贝到SpringBoot项目中resources/static/目录下,而后即可以像第4步那样直接访问了。
步骤5中需要大家对NodeJS、NPM等有肯定的使用经验,不熟习的小伙伴可以先自行搜索学习下,推荐Vue官方教程。
vue人力管理_springboot+vue微人事人力资源管理系统,前后台分离源码相关推荐
- 基于SSM实现的人力资源管理系统【附源码】(毕设)
一.项目简介 本项目是一套基于SSM实现的人力资源管理系统 或 人事管理系统 或 企业管理系统 或 HR管理系统,主要针对计算机相关专业的正在做毕设的学生与需要项目实战练习的Java学习者. 详细介绍 ...
- springboot+人事信息管理系统 毕业设计-附源码221507
Springboot人事信息管理系统 摘 要 信息化社会内需要与之针对性的信息获取途径,但是途径的扩展基本上为人们所努力的方向,由于站在的角度存在偏差,人们经常能够获得不同类型信息,这也是技术最为难以 ...
- Springboot人事信息管理系统毕业设计-附源码221507
摘 要 信息化社会内需要与之针对性的信息获取途径,但是途径的扩展基本上为人们所努力的方向,由于站在的角度存在偏差,人们经常能够获得不同类型信息,这也是技术最为难以攻克的课题.针对人事信息管理系统等问题 ...
- 比较简单的初学者模仿毕业设计项目springboot人力资源管理系统.rar(项目源码+数据库文件)
idea.eclipse开发工具都可以直接导入运行该项目,mysql8.0数据库 主要实现了员工信息管理.部门管理.职位管理.考勤管理.打卡信息管理.请假信息管理.薪资管理.薪资结算等基本功能. Th ...
- Python+Vue计算机毕业设计鹏飞书店图书销售管理系统4y8jb(源码+程序+LW+部署)
该项目含有源码.文档.程序.数据库.配套开发软件.软件安装教程 项目运行环境配置: Python3.7.7+Django+Mysql5.7+pip list+HBuilderX(Vscode也行)+V ...
- java计算机毕业设计vue健康餐饮管理系统设计与实现MyBatis+系统+LW文档+源码+调试部署
java计算机毕业设计vue健康餐饮管理系统设计与实现MyBatis+系统+LW文档+源码+调试部署 java计算机毕业设计vue健康餐饮管理系统设计与实现MyBatis+系统+LW文档+源码+调试部 ...
- 基于java基于vue的百乐儿童玩具公司管理系统计算机毕业设计源码+系统+lw文档+mysql数据库+调试部署
基于java基于vue的百乐儿童玩具公司管理系统计算机毕业设计源码+系统+lw文档+mysql数据库+调试部署 基于java基于vue的百乐儿童玩具公司管理系统计算机毕业设计源码+系统+lw文档+my ...
- 基于java基于VUE的个人记账管理系统计算机毕业设计源码+系统+lw文档+mysql数据库+调试部署
基于java基于VUE的个人记账管理系统计算机毕业设计源码+系统+lw文档+mysql数据库+调试部署 基于java基于VUE的个人记账管理系统计算机毕业设计源码+系统+lw文档+mysql数据库+调 ...
- java计算机毕业设计ssm基于Vue的校园电脑租赁系统设计与开发19xy6(附源码、数据库)
java计算机毕业设计ssm基于Vue的校园电脑租赁系统设计与开发19xy6(附源码.数据库) 项目运行 环境配置: Jdk1.8 + Tomcat8.5 + Mysql + HBuilderX(We ...
最新文章
- 【数学专题】约数个数与欧拉函数
- ORACLE11g中创建裸设备
- 21天学MySQL_把整个Mysql拆分成21天,轻松掌握,搞定(下)
- Apache的压缩与缓存-----网页优化
- Parity 錢包合約漏洞
- 中国物联网2020年将达到1660亿美元的市场规模
- Python之递归函数
- 如何使用ping命令检查网络故障
- 详解图示+例题演练——BF算法+KMP算法基本原理
- 你必须知道的session与cookie
- 〖Demo〗-- HAproxy配置文件操作
- vue打包后获取不到数据_vue 打包后,如何修改接口地址?
- Win10+Python3.6配置Spark创建分布式爬虫
- 理解并行和并发的区别?
- 浅谈jQuery Mobile设计思想
- 美国在线教育的启示:教育领域正在革命
- 网易新闻iOS版开发使用的第三方框架和组件列表
- Linux终端默认配色方案
- 玲听 | 蚂蚁金服布局区块链核心3问
- 超越“虚拟的美丽”——云计算实践再分析
热门文章
- vue校验密码的三种写法
- 路由器交换机设备管理
- 帧缓冲区对象 FBO
- python快速注释html5_python注释代码块
- axure form列表_AxureRP教程
- 关联查询(多表查询)
- SyntaxError: invalid syntax(遇到问题)(已解决)
- 可兼容所有浏览器的“收藏本站”、“设为首页”js代码
- matlab 求已知概率密度函数的随机数生成
- 解决Ubuntu 20.04 播放视频,因缺少编解码器无法处理音频/视频流,以及解决‘因没有公钥,无法验证下列签名’问题